SUMMARY & RECOMMENDATION
In November 2003, the firm ofPBS&J, Inc. was selected to perform a study of the Little Cedar
Bayou Wastewater Treatment Plant to determine future needs for the aeration portion of the
facility. As a part of the Study, the existing aeration equipment was determined to have reached
its useful life (20+ years) and should be replaced. The current CIP budget includes funding of
$625,000 for the replacement of this equipment.
PBS&J, Inc. has submitted a proposal to provide professional engineering services to produce
plans and specifications to complete the Project. A copy of the proposal and proposed agreement
is attached. Total cost to provide the services is $24,800.
Action Required bv Council: Approve an Ordinance authorizing the City Manager to execute a
Professional Service Agreement with PBS&J to professional engineering services for equipment
replacement at the Little Cedar Bayou Wastewater Treatment Plant in the amount of $24,800.00.
